Informa Markets in India has announced the 18th edition of Renewable Energy India (REI) Expo 2025, Asia’s largest clean energy event, scheduled from October 30 to November 1, 2025, at the India Expo Mart, Greater Noida.
The event will be co-located with the 3rd edition of The Battery Show India (TBSI), together showcasing the full spectrum of innovations driving India’s clean energy transition under the theme “Decoding Pathways to Achieve Net Zero.”
A Global Platform for Renewable Energy Collaboration
Building on the success of its 17th edition in 2024, REI 2025 aims to set new benchmarks for sustainability, innovation, and industry partnerships. The event will feature 700+ exhibitors, 1,000 brands, 35,000 visitors, and 250 global thought leaders including policymakers, investors, and technology innovators.
The exhibition will span solar energy, battery storage, EV charging infrastructure, biomass, and wind technologies, offering a comprehensive view of the renewable value chain.
Co-located with The Battery Show India (TBSI), South Asia’s premier event for advanced battery manufacturing and energy storage, the combined expo will cover the entire clean energy ecosystem—from generation to storage and mobility solutions. Backed by strong institutional support from the Department of Science & Technology and the Ministry of Heavy Industries, TBSI 2025 will host over 350 exhibitors and 400+ brands, attracting more than 20,000 professionals from across the global energy and mobility sectors.

India’s Clean Energy and EV Momentum
India’s clean energy transition continues at an unprecedented pace, with non-fossil fuel capacity reaching 242.8 GW, of which 234 GW comes from renewables—a dramatic rise from 76 GW in 2014. The country is on track to invest over US$ 360 billion in renewable energy and infrastructure by 2030, aiming for 500 GW of non-fossil capacity.
The Battery Show India complements this growth, aligning with the rapid expansion of the Indian EV and energy storage market. The EV battery market is projected to grow from USD 16.77 billion in 2023 to USD 27.70 billion by 2028, while the Battery Management System market is set to rise from USD 278 million in 2024 to USD 1.22 billion by 2033, at a CAGR of 17.9 percent.
